怎样查VASP的力收敛情况?
发布网友
发布时间:2024-05-01 12:27
我来回答
共1个回答
热心网友
时间:2024-05-15 22:44
查看VASP力收敛的方法是在VASP输出文件中查找离子步骤的收敛信息,特别是关注每个离子步骤中的力和能量的变化。
VASP(Vienna Ab initio Simulation Package)是一款广泛用于计算材料电子结构和量子力学性质的软件包。在VASP中,力收敛是一个重要的指标,用于判断计算是否达到平衡状态。当系统达到力收敛时,意味着原子间的作用力已经平衡,原子不再发生明显的移动。
要查看VASP的力收敛情况,首先需要打开VASP的输出文件,通常是以“OUTCAR”命名的文件。在该文件中,可以找到一个描述离子步骤(ionic steps)的部分。每个离子步骤都会列出当前步骤的原子位置、力(forces)和能量(energy)等信息。
为了判断力是否收敛,需要关注力的大小和变化趋势。如果力的大小逐渐减小并趋于零,同时能量的变化也趋于稳定,那么可以认为系统已经达到力收敛。具体来说,如果连续几个离子步骤中的最大力(max force)都小于一个设定的阈值(例如0.01 eV/Å),那么可以认为系统已经收敛。
举个例子,以下是一个典型的VASP输出文件中关于离子步骤和力收敛的信息:
Ionic step: 1
Energy: -10.000 eV
Max force: 0.500 eV/Å
Ionic step: 2
Energy: -10.100 eV
Max force: 0.300 eV/Å
Ionic step: 3
Energy: -10.120 eV
Max force: 0.100 eV/Å
从上面的例子中可以看出,随着离子步骤的增加,能量逐渐降低并趋于稳定,而最大力也逐渐减小。在第三步时,最大力已经小于0.1 eV/Å,这通常被认为是一个合理的力收敛阈值。因此,可以判断该系统在第三步时已经达到力收敛。
需要注意的是,力收敛的阈值应该根据具体的计算体系和需求来确定。对于一些需要高精度计算的情况,可能需要设置更严格的力收敛阈值。